A smart video doorbell combines a camera, motion sensor, microphone, speaker, wireless connectivity, mobile app, and cloud or edge storage into a single front-door intelligence point. For homeowners, tenants, multifamily operators, and small businesses, the value proposition is no longer limited to answering the door remotely; it includes deterrence, delivery verification, visitor authentication, integration with smart locks, and real-time alerts. Competitive advantage is increasingly tied to video quality, battery life, privacy controls, cybersecurity, subscription flexibility, and compatibility with major smart home and Matter-enabled frameworks.
The smart doorbell landscape is being transformed by the convergence of home security, consumer electronics, AI video analytics, and cloud services. Buyers increasingly compare connected doorbell cameras on end-to-end experience rather than hardware alone, including app reliability, false-alert reduction, night vision, two-way audio, local storage, and integration with smart locks, alarms, lighting, and home energy systems.
Market structure is also shifting as device makers respond to privacy regulation, cybersecurity expectations, and subscription fatigue. The Connectivity Standards Alliance's Matter protocol is encouraging interoperability across smart home ecosystems, while regulators in the United States, European Union, and other jurisdictions are increasing scrutiny of connected device security, biometric data handling, and video retention. These shifts favor vendors that combine secure-by-design hardware, transparent data governance, flexible storage options, and scalable service revenue without eroding consumer trust.
Artificial intelligence is becoming a major differentiator in the smart doorbell market. AI-enabled video doorbells use computer vision to distinguish people, pets, vehicles, packages, and routine motion, helping reduce false notifications that historically limited user satisfaction. Edge AI, where inference is performed on the device rather than exclusively in the cloud, can improve response time, reduce bandwidth consumption, and support stronger privacy by limiting the amount of raw video transmitted.
The cumulative impact of AI extends across product design, customer support, and security operations. Device makers are using machine learning to improve low-light imaging, facial and object recognition where legally permitted, audio event detection, and predictive battery management. At the same time, AI raises governance requirements: companies must address bias in computer vision models, comply with privacy laws such as the GDPR, align with emerging AI risk frameworks such as the NIST AI Risk Management Framework, and ensure automated alerts do not create unsafe or discriminatory outcomes.
Asia-Pacific represents one of the most dynamic environments for smart doorbells, supported by dense urban housing, high mobile internet use, expanding middle-income households, and rapid smart city investment. China, India, Japan, South Korea, Australia, and ASEAN markets show different adoption patterns, but all benefit from smartphone-based access control, apartment security needs, and increasing consumer familiarity with app-connected devices.
North America remains a leading region for video doorbell adoption because of high household broadband availability, established e-commerce delivery behavior, large single-family housing stock, and strong retail channels for DIY smart home products. Latin America is gaining momentum as urban security concerns, mobile-first connectivity, and rising online retail encourage demand for affordable connected doorbell cameras, although price sensitivity and network reliability remain important constraints.
Europe is shaped by strong privacy regulation, energy-efficiency expectations, and high demand for interoperable smart home systems. GDPR compliance, transparent consent practices, and secure data storage are central to vendor credibility. In the Middle East, premium residential development, smart city programs, and high-income urban communities support adoption, especially in the GCC. Africa remains earlier in the adoption curve, but mobile broadband expansion, urbanization, and demand for practical security solutions create long-term opportunities for durable, low-bandwidth, and solar-compatible smart doorbell designs.
ASEAN demand is led by urban apartment living, mobile-first consumers, and rising interest in affordable smart home security across Singapore, Malaysia, Thailand, Indonesia, Vietnam, and the Philippines. Vendors that localize mobile apps, support multilingual interfaces, and offer low-bandwidth video performance are well positioned. In the GCC, smart doorbells align with smart city strategies, luxury housing, and integrated property management, with strong opportunities for premium devices connected to access control, smart locks, and community security platforms.
The European Union is a regulation-led market where interoperability, data minimization, cybersecurity labeling, and GDPR-compliant video handling are commercial requirements rather than optional features. BRICS economies combine large populations, fast urbanization, and growing domestic electronics ecosystems, making them important for localized production, cost-competitive design, and broad smart home adoption. G7 markets are characterized by high purchasing power, mature retail channels, and stronger scrutiny of connected-device security. NATO member countries add a cybersecurity dimension, as consumer IoT resilience is increasingly viewed as part of broader digital infrastructure protection.
The United States is the most visible smart doorbell market, supported by large home security spending, high parcel delivery volume, and strong adoption of app-based connected home products. Canada shows similar demand drivers, with emphasis on weather durability and privacy. Mexico and Brazil are expanding through urban security needs and mobile connectivity, while affordability, network stability, and professional installation partnerships remain important.
In Europe, the United Kingdom demonstrates strong consumer familiarity with video doorbells and DIY security, while Germany and France prioritize privacy, data protection, and reliable engineering. Italy and Spain benefit from apartment security and retrofit demand, and Russia's market is influenced by domestic platform ecosystems, import availability, and localized cloud infrastructure considerations. Across these markets, GDPR-aligned design, consent transparency, and secure video management are decisive.
China is a major innovation and manufacturing hub for smart doorbells, with strong domestic smart home ecosystems and cost-competitive hardware supply. India is positioned for long-term expansion as urban housing, smartphone access, and security awareness increase. Japan and South Korea emphasize compact design, high connectivity, and integration with broader smart living platforms. Australia combines high detached-home ownership, parcel delivery growth, and demand for weather-resistant outdoor security devices.
Industry leaders should prioritize secure-by-design product architecture, including encrypted video transmission, multi-factor authentication, regular firmware updates, and clear vulnerability disclosure processes. These capabilities are increasingly necessary as governments and standards bodies raise expectations for consumer IoT security.
Product roadmaps should balance AI sophistication with privacy and affordability. Edge AI for person, vehicle, and package detection can improve user experience while reducing cloud dependence. Vendors should also offer flexible storage models, including local storage, encrypted cloud subscriptions, and hybrid options, to address subscription fatigue and regional privacy requirements.
Commercial strategy should be region-specific. Premium markets reward interoperability, privacy assurances, and advanced analytics, while emerging markets need durable hardware, efficient compression, local language support, and accessible pricing. Partnerships with telecom operators, insurers, builders, property managers, and smart lock providers can accelerate adoption and create recurring service opportunities.
